Chest pain in the intensive care unit (ICU) is a critical symptom that demands a swift and systematic approach to identify potentially life-threatening conditions. Differentiating between cardiac and noncardiac causes is of paramount importance, and utilizing structured assessment tools can significantly enhance diagnostic accuracy. The pain can be visceral or somatic. Visceral pain is usually dull and over a larger area without any localization; whereas somatic pain is usually sharp, stabbing, and localized to a specific spot/area (dermatomal distribution). Importantly, clinicians must recognize that chest pain presentations can vary across different populations. Women, for instance, may experience symptoms beyond chest pain, such as nausea, fatigue, or shortness of breath, which can lead to underdiagnosis. Older adults often present with atypical symptoms like shortness of breath or confusion rather than chest pain alone. This chapter presents a comprehensive algorithm for evaluating chest pain in the ICU, incorporating current international guidelines, risk stratification methods, and considerations for diverse populations to ensure prompt and appropriate management [1, 2].
